Revenue Manager Visa Sponsorship Jobs in Georgia

Revenue manager visa sponsorship jobs in Georgia are concentrated in Atlanta, where hospitality giants like Marriott, Hilton, and IHG operate major properties and regional offices. The city's status as a convention hub and home to Hartsfield-Jackson airport drives consistent demand for revenue management professionals across hotels, airlines, and technology companies.

Revenue Manager Jobs in Georgia: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ies in Georgia sponsor visas for revenue managers?

Atlanta-based hospitality and travel companies are the most active sponsors. Major hotel operators including Marriott, Hilton, Hyatt, and IHG regularly sponsor H-1B visas for revenue management roles at their Georgia properties and regional offices. Delta Air Lines, headquartered in Atlanta, also hires revenue managers and has an established sponsorship track record. Technology firms in Atlanta's growing tech sector occasionally sponsor for revenue analytics roles as well.

What visa types are most commonly used for revenue manager roles in Georgia?

The H-1B is the most common visa category for revenue manager positions in Georgia, as the role typically requires a bachelor's degree in hospitality management, finance, or business analytics, qualifying it as a specialty occupation. Candidates with Canadian or Mexican citizenship may qualify for TN visas under the NAFTA/USMCA professional category. Australian citizens can explore the E-3 visa as an alternative to H-1B.

Which cities in Georgia have the most revenue manager visa sponsorship opportunities?

Atlanta is by far the primary market, driven by its dense concentration of hotel headquarters, regional corporate offices, and proximity to Hartsfield-Jackson, one of the world's busiest airports. Savannah sees smaller but notable demand tied to its tourism and convention industry. Outside these two cities, sponsorship opportunities for revenue managers in Georgia are limited, so most international candidates focus their search on the Atlanta metro area.

Are there any Georgia-specific factors that affect visa sponsorship for revenue managers?

Georgia employers sponsoring H-1B visas for revenue managers must pay the Department of Labor prevailing wage for the role in the specific metropolitan area, which differs between the Atlanta metro and smaller Georgia markets. Georgia State University and the University of Georgia produce graduates in hospitality and business analytics, meaning employers have access to both domestic and OPT-eligible international graduates, which influences how actively they pursue full H-1B sponsorship for mid-career hires.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ored revenue manager jobs in Georgia?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
